Output d7214ffbc8c827efe0616255f7ef613bae07c1835065527a4002044382641546:39

value
3952573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32b7e291fde772352ea95ec5858c4d5b7564ac3 OP_EQUAL
address
3KUyntFYaaiZpq5q1LGZsUHrfNxJTCEL9v
transaction
d7214ffbc8c827efe0616255f7ef613bae07c1835065527a4002044382641546
confirmations
177671
spent
true